Medicare Basics

Original Medicare is offered by the US government to folks who are over age 65 or under 65 and on are handicap. Medicare is made up of Parts A and B. Part A covers hospital insurance and Part B covers doctor visits and outpatient services. Normally, Medicare covers 80% of the invoice so there is 20% left combined with many deductibles copays and coinsurances. Because of these openings left over many folks choose to get a Medicare Supplement Plan to pay what Medicare does not fully pay for, these plans are also referred to as Medigap plans.

Medicare Supplement Outline

There are 10 standardized Medicare supplement plans available. The most popular Medicare supplement plans are programs F, G, & N. Because the programs are standardized and the benefits are governed by the US government there is no gap in policy between carriers for the exact same plan. By way of instance, Medigap plan G is exactly the same whether it’s offered by Mutual of Omaha, Aetna, Cigna, or any other company. In any given state in the U.S. there are approximately 30 or more carriers offering these plans, each in a different cost.

With almost any standardized Medigap insurance plan you can see any doctor anywhere in the nation that accepts Medicare, no referrals required. Also plans F, N and G have a restricted foreign travel benefit that’s useful for those folks May travel beyond the country.

Additionally, it is essential to be aware that prescription coverage isn’t provided on any standardized Medicare Supplement Plan, it’s covered under another program known as part D.

These programs can also be guaranteed-renewable for life, premiums can’t be increased due to health or canceled as a result of health.

Medicare Supplement Plan F

Medicare Supplement Plan F is the most comprehensive of all Medicare supplement plans and also the most expensive. Coverage is fairly straightforward, this plan covers everything Medicare doesn’t totally cover, such as the 20% and most of deductibles copays and coinsurances. Having a option F, you should never have a health bill, as long as the services you receive are approved by Medicare.

Supplemental Plan G

Medicare supplement plan G is the most popular option in 2021. Medigap plan G is thought to be the most cost-effective option when compared with the other Medicare supplement plans available. This plan option is very similar to Plan F, it insures 100% of everything except for the part B deductible that isn’t insured and that allowance is $203 in 2021.

The reason plan G is considered the most cost-effective plan is because compared against Plan F, the sum of money you save in high is more than the difference, which can be (amount) in (year). Additionally, the rate increases normally, historically are somewhat less on Plan G compared to Plan F. Supplemental Medigap Plan N

Plan N is comparable to insurance plan G, except the next out-of-pocket expenditures on Plan N:

$0-$20 office visit copay
$50 in the emergency room (waived if admitted)
Part B excess charges aren’t covered

Plan N is a potential great fit for someone who does not find the doctor on a regular basis, this person wouldn’t incur the office visit copay each time they visit the physician. If you’re wanting to save some premium dollars Plan N may be fantastic fit for you.

When Is The Best Time To Buy?

The ideal time to buy a Medigap plan is whenever you are new to Medicare, either turning 65 or starting Medicare Part B for the first time. The main reason this is the very best time is this is considered to be “Open enrollment” and can buy any plan you wish, no health questions are asked.

If you’re buying a plan outside of “open enrollment” you might need to answer health questions and be subject to health underwriting to become approved. It is possible that you can be turned down.
